Transaction 75bf4e7c906c259825349c41301ffde327cb42f9e81fd1dbad586d6b660bb7fc
1 Input
1 Output
-
75bf4e7c906c259825349c41301ffde327cb42f9e81fd1dbad586d6b660bb7fc:0
- value
- 1006828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 409577ab7de09882a397642b4ceb1abf5511cc9d OP_EQUAL
- address
- 37aWE15PW8Ss8g5yxqZvJA7tzJHqH1cbXE